Elo Touch Solutions is a multinational company specializing in touchscreen hardware and interactive display systems. It produces touchmonitors, touchcomputers, and related peripherals for sectors such as retail, hospitality, healthcare, transportation, and industrial automation. Product lines encompass projected-capacitive touchscreens, resistive touch sensors, surface acoustic wave panels, and infrared touchframes used in interactive kiosks and point-of-sale terminals. R&D efforts focus on touch accuracy, multi-touch gestures, stylus integration, antimicrobial screen coatings, and ruggedization for harsh environments.
